It contended that the traditional eight-yr statute of limitations for doping offenses did not utilize due to Armstrong's "fraudulent concealment" of his doping. Armstrong, USADA said, could not be permitted to take pleasure in the statute when he lied below oath in equally the SCA scenario as well as French investigation, intimidated witnesses and submitted affidavits that he understood were Phony. Longstanding precedent in U.S. courts retains which the statute of limitations won't apply each time a defendant engages in fraudulent acts.[26][27][28]
Simply because Mr. Armstrong could have had a Listening to ahead of neutral arbitrators to contest USADA’s proof and sanction and he voluntarily chose not to do so, USADA’s sanction is remaining.
USADA explained Armstrong's choice never to struggle the charges from him brought on the lifetime ban and triggered his success courting back again to 1 August 1998 staying erased.

On December fourteen, Armstrong met secretly with USADA CEO Travis Tygart within the workplaces of the previous Colorado governor Bill Ritter, inquiring USADA to cut back his lifetime ban from athletics to just one yr in Trade for his cooperation with its ongoing investigations, which includes its situation against Bruyneel. Tygart explained to Armstrong that under the anti-doping regulations, USADA could bring his ban right down to eight yrs, and mentioned that cooperating with USADA would enable Armstrong to enhance his community image.
On October ten, USADA published the details of its investigation, in a very 200-web page report accompanied by over a thousand web pages of supporting evidence. The report provided testimonies from eleven former Armstrong teammates and fifteen other witnesses. It portrayed Armstrong as the mastermind of what it described as "quite possibly the most subtle, professionalized and prosperous doping system that sport has at any time noticed." The report detailed numerous blood check effects that proved Armstrong was guilty of blood doping, along with above US£1 million in payments to Ferrari.
